14. Pulse motor
valve (PMV)
control
Operation flow and applicable data, etc.
This function controls throttle amount of the refrigerant in
the refrigerating cycle.
According to operating status of the air conditioner, this
function also controls the open degree of valve with an
expansion valve with pulse motor.
Description
1) When starting the operation, move
the valve once until it fits to the
stopper. (Initialize)
* In this time, “Click” sound may be
heard.
2) Adjust the open degree of valve by
super heat amount. (SH control)
3) If the discharge temperature was
excessively up, adjust the open
degree of valve so that it is in the
range of set temperature. (Dis-
charge temp. control)
* During control of No. of revolution
of the compressor, the open
degree of valve is adjusted before
release operation.
4) When defrost operation is per-
formed, the open degree of valve is
adjusted according to each setup
conditions during preparation for
defrost and during defrost operation
(4-way valve is inversed.).
5) To turn off the compressor while the
air conditioner stops by control of
the thermostat or by remote
controller, adjust the open degree of
valve to the setup value before stop
of the compressor.
6) If No. of revolution of the compres-
sor continuously varied during the
operation, correct the open degree
according to the varied No. of
revolution of the compressor.
7) If the refrigerant got dry from Tc
sensor (Indoor heat exchanger
temperature) position in cooling
operation, open forcibly the open
degree of valve based upon the
conditions.
8) An error detected on SH controlling
status due to PMV error, tempera-
ture sensor error, etc. is judged as
PMV error. In this case, execute an
emergent operation. (Operation
restricting the upper/lower limits of
No. of revolution of the compressor,
setting PMV as the fixed open
degree) (or stop in emergency)
* SH (Super Heat amount) =
Ts (Temperature of suction hose of the compressor) –
Tc or Te (Heat exchanger temperature at evaporation side)
* PMV: Pulse Motor Valve
A remote controller operates only one indoor unit.
When two indoor units are installed in a room or in two
adjacent rooms, this function prevents that two indoor units
receive concurrently a signal from the remote controller as
only one unit is to be operated.
15. Select
switch on
remote
controller
The indoor unit of which SELECT
switch on the remote controller is set
to B receives the signal sent from the
remote controller set to B.
(At shipment from the factory, SELECT
switch on the remote controller is set
to A. There is no display of A setting.)
